Lines Matching refs:ip_serial_regs
465 struct ioc4_serialregs __iomem *ip_serial_regs; member
834 writel(IOC4_SSCR_RESET, &port->ip_serial_regs->sscr); in port_init()
842 writel(0, &port->ip_serial_regs->sscr); in port_init()
847 port->ip_tx_prod = readl(&port->ip_serial_regs->stcir) & PROD_CONS_MASK; in port_init()
848 writel(port->ip_tx_prod, &port->ip_serial_regs->stpir); in port_init()
849 port->ip_rx_cons = readl(&port->ip_serial_regs->srpir) & PROD_CONS_MASK; in port_init()
850 writel(port->ip_rx_cons | IOC4_SRCIR_ARM, &port->ip_serial_regs->srcir); in port_init()
900 writel(IOC4_SRTR_HZ / 100, &port->ip_serial_regs->srtr); in port_init()
905 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in port_init()
1120 port->ip_serial_regs = &(port->ip_serial->port_0); in ioc4_attach_local()
1124 port->ip_serial_regs = &(port->ip_serial->port_1); in ioc4_attach_local()
1128 port->ip_serial_regs = &(port->ip_serial->port_2); in ioc4_attach_local()
1133 port->ip_serial_regs = &(port->ip_serial->port_3); in ioc4_attach_local()
1169 (void *)port->ip_serial_regs, in ioc4_attach_local()
1227 &port->ip_serial_regs->sscr); in local_open()
1228 while((readl(&port->ip_serial_regs-> sscr) in local_open()
1258 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in local_open()
1291 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in set_rx_timeout()
1300 writel(timeout, &port->ip_serial_regs->srtr); in set_rx_timeout()
1346 &port->ip_serial_regs->sscr); in config_port()
1347 while((readl(&port->ip_serial_regs->sscr) in config_port()
1378 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in config_port()
1412 cons_ptr = readl(&port->ip_serial_regs->stcir) & PROD_CONS_MASK; in do_write()
1461 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in do_write()
1468 writel(prod_ptr, &port->ip_serial_regs->stpir); in do_write()
1545 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in set_notification()
1569 &port->ip_serial_regs->sscr); in set_mcr()
1570 while ((readl(&port->ip_serial_regs->sscr) in set_mcr()
1577 shadow = readl(&port->ip_serial_regs->shadow); in set_mcr()
1585 writel(shadow, &port->ip_serial_regs->shadow); in set_mcr()
1589 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in set_mcr()
1764 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in ioc4_change_speed()
1879 shadow = readl(&port->ip_serial_regs->shadow); in handle_intr()
1901 shadow = readl(&port->ip_serial_regs->shadow); in handle_intr()
2007 &port->ip_serial_regs->sscr); in handle_intr()
2102 writel(port->ip_rx_cons | IOC4_SRCIR_ARM, &port->ip_serial_regs->srcir); in do_read()
2104 prod_ptr = readl(&port->ip_serial_regs->srpir) & PROD_CONS_MASK; in do_read()
2125 &port->ip_serial_regs->sscr); in do_read()
2126 prod_ptr = readl(&port->ip_serial_regs->srpir) in do_read()
2138 while (readl(&port->ip_serial_regs->sscr) & in do_read()
2148 prod_ptr = readl(&port->ip_serial_regs->srpir) in do_read()
2153 writel(port->ip_sscr, &port->ip_serial_regs->sscr); in do_read()
2234 &port->ip_serial_regs->srcir); in do_read()
2321 writel(cons_ptr, &port->ip_serial_regs->srcir); in do_read()
2395 if (readl(&port->ip_serial_regs->shadow) & IOC4_SHADOW_TEMT) in ic4_tx_empty()
2495 shadow = readl(&port->ip_serial_regs->shadow); in ic4_get_mctrl()